We proposed a novel straight line detection method that can exclude line segments belonging to curved lines and integrates line segments of the same straight line. The proposed method links the edge pixels into strips and segments each strip into a series of line segments. We present a novel method for fusing the results of multiple land mine detection algorithms which use different sensors, features, and different classification methods. Cerium doped lutetium oxyorthosilicate scintillators, such as LYSO, which possess high stopping power, high light output and fast decay time, are promising candidates for use in positron emission tomography.
